It doesn"t make any sense except a personal zest and zeal for wander-lust. The Indian undertakes this lengthy and risky odyssey in a canoe, but no reason or point for the trip is given. He is alone so does not interact with other people- and it gets a little monotonous, only relieved by the song-like ( it is not a song) chant, Paddle, Paddle, to the Sea. The reason for the voyage is never given and this puzzled me as a kid- he is not going fishing, for example. To tell you the truth I never could figure it out,.
